设置用户属性

用户属性是为描述您的各个细分用户群而定义的属性,例如语言首选项或地理位置。

Analytics 会自动记录一些用户属性;您无需为此添加任何代码。如果您的应用需要收集其他数据,您可以在应用中设置所需的各种 Analytics 用户属性,最多可达 25 种。

准备工作

确保您已按照 C++ 版 Analytics 使用入门中的说明设置了您的项目,并且可以访问 Analytics。

设置用户属性

您可以设置 Analytics 用户属性来描述应用的用户,并且可以通过将这些属性用作报告的过滤条件来分析各个用户细分的行为。

按如下方式设置用户属性:

  1. Firebase 控制台Analytics 标签页中注册属性。

  2. 添加代码以使用 SetUserProperty() 方法设置 Analytics 用户属性。您可以为每个属性使用自己选择的名称和值。

下面的示例展示了如何添加一个假设性的“最喜欢的食物”属性,将字符串 mFavoriteFood 中的值分配给活跃用户:

SetUserProperty("favorite_food", mFavoriteFood);

您可以按如下方式访问这些数据:

  1. Firebase 控制台中,打开您的项目。
  2. 从菜单中选择 Analytics 以查看 Analytics 报告信息中心。

用户属性标签页显示您已为应用定义的用户属性的列表。您可以将这些属性用作 Google Analytics(分析)中提供的许多报告的过滤条件。要详细了解 Analytics 报告信息中心,请访问 Firebase 帮助中心。